I'm watching Last of the Comanches ... I had never seen this 1952 B western with Broderick Crawford as a cavalry sergeant...
It is complete with Hollywood Henrys, set in 1876 ( they mention Custer's Late Stand as just a few months pasted ).
Now as the plot unveils , I think I seen this plot before.....

Yep it is Sahara the 1943 Humphrey Bogart WW2 film....  complete with desert ruin and dripping almost dry well.
instead of a M3 Lee Tank , it's a Butterfield Stage , instead of Germans it's Comanches.
I mean right down to the same Dialog ...almost word for word ....
I'm sitting having never seen it before and knowing exactly what will happen next ....

dang this is annoying
 
and Sahara was a remake of a Russian film Trinadtsat (1937)
